Entries open for Beluga Signature 2019


Beluga Signature

Beluga Vodka has announced the launch of the fourth edition of its on-trade multistage bartender programme Beluga Signature.

This year, the educational and competitive programme will build on the theme of delivering luxury experiences to guests.

To begin, bartenders are required to submit a classic vodka cocktail with a local twist by 28 February 2018.

As a result of the online shortlisting, 30 participants from each country will receive a full day of education from industry experts, including Beluga Signature educational director Philip Duff and Marian Beke of The Gibson.

Following the educational stage, the Beluga Signature Bartender School attendees will create and submit another drink. Ten shortlisted contestants from each country will then have to present their creations in front of the panel of judges in May.

In September, seven global finalists will travel to Moscow and compete for the title of Beluga Signature global ambassador.

On top of representing Beluga at global industry events such as Bar Convent Berlin, Tales of the Cocktails, Bar Convent Brazil, the winner will receive a one week internship in one of the 50 World’s Best Bars.

Philp said: “The hospitality industry is centred on the guest whose satisfaction is a main marker of success in a bartender’s career.

“Last year the seminars were about building a profitable bar, reading your guests and creating cutting-edge flavours using avant-garde techniques.

“This year we will talk about consistency of the luxury service, creating a memorable experience for your guest and, most importantly, applying your creativity consistently.”
